S5KL-TP Equivalent & Substitute Parts

Part Overview

The S5KL-TP is a general-purpose rectifier diode manufactured by Micro Commercial Co, rated for 800 V DC reverse voltage and 5 A average rectified current in a surface mount SMC (DO-214AB) package. This component is classified as Active product status and is RoHS3 compliant. Key Parameters

Parameter Value Unit
Voltage - DC Reverse (Vr) (Max) 800 V
Current - Average Rectified (Io) 5 A
Voltage - Forward (Vf) (Max) @ If 1.2 @ 5 V @ A
Speed Standard Recovery >500ns, > 200mA (Io) -
Current - Reverse Leakage @ Vr 10 @ 800 µA @ V
Package / Case DO-214AB, SMC -
Operating Temperature - Junction -55 to 150 °C
RoHS Status ROHS3 Compliant -
Moisture Sensitivity Level (MSL) 1 (Unlimited) -

Substitute Part Grouping Explanation

Substitute parts for the S5KL-TP are identified based on the following critical parameters that determine functional equivalence:

Primary Substitution Criteria:

  • Voltage - DC Reverse (Vr) (Max): Equal to or greater than 800 V
  • Current - Average Rectified (Io): Equal to or greater than 5 A
  • Package / Case: DO-214AB, SMC (mechanical compatibility)
  • Mounting Type: Surface Mount
  • RoHS Status: ROHS3 Compliant
  • Moisture Sensitivity Level: 1 (Unlimited)

Secondary Compatibility Factors:

  • Voltage - Forward (Vf) (Max) @ If: Within acceptable operating range
  • Current - Reverse Leakage @ Vr: Consistent with standard rectifier specifications
  • Operating Temperature - Junction: Suitable for intended application environment
  • Product Status: Active

Substitute parts are grouped into two categories based on voltage rating alignment:

Category 1 - Direct Voltage Match (800 V): Parts with 800 V DC reverse voltage rating provide direct electrical equivalence to the S5KL-TP.

Category 2 - Higher Voltage Rating (1000 V): Parts with 1000 V DC reverse voltage rating exceed the minimum requirement and are suitable for applications where the S5KL-TP is specified, provided circuit design accommodates the higher voltage capability.

Parameter Comparison

Parameter S5KL-TP (Main) S5KC-13-F S5M_R1_00001 STTH310S
Manufacturer Micro Commercial Co Diodes Incorporated Panjit International Inc. STMicroelectronics
Voltage - DC Reverse (Vr) (Max) 800 V 800 V 1000 V 1000 V
Current - Average Rectified (Io) 5 A 5 A 5 A 3 A
Voltage - Forward (Vf) (Max) @ If 1.2 V @ 5 A 1.15 V @ 5 A 1.1 V @ 5 A 1.7 V @ 3 A
Speed Standard Recovery >500ns, > 200mA (Io) Standard Recovery >500ns, > 200mA (Io) Standard Recovery >500ns, > 200mA (Io) Fast Recovery =< 500ns, > 200mA (Io)
Current - Reverse Leakage @ Vr 10 µA @ 800 V 10 µA @ 800 V 10 µA @ 1000 V 10 µA @ 1000 V
Package / Case DO-214AB, SMC DO-214AB, SMC DO-214AB, SMC DO-214AB, SMC
Operating Temperature - Junction -55°C ~ 150°C -65°C ~ 150°C -55°C ~ 150°C -40°C ~ 175°C
RoHS Status ROHS3 Compliant ROHS3 Compliant ROHS3 Compliant ROHS3 Compliant
Moisture Sensitivity Level (MSL) 1 (Unlimited) 1 (Unlimited) 1 (Unlimited) 1 (Unlimited)
Product Status Active Active Active Active

Engineering Selection Recommendations

S5KC-13-F (Diodes Incorporated)

The S5KC-13-F is a direct electrical equivalent to the S5KL-TP, matching the 800 V DC reverse voltage and 5 A current rating. Both components share identical package specifications (DO-214AB, SMC), mounting type (Surface Mount), and compliance certifications (ROHS3, MSL 1). The S5KC-13-F exhibits a lower forward voltage drop (1.15 V versus 1.2 V at 5 A), which may provide marginal efficiency benefits in power conversion applications. Operating temperature range extends to -65°C, providing enhanced low-temperature performance compared to the S5KL-TP. This part is suitable for direct substitution in applications where the S5KL-TP is specified.

S5M_R1_00001 (Panjit International Inc.)

The S5M_R1_00001 is rated for 1000 V DC reverse voltage with 5 A average rectified current, exceeding the S5KL-TP voltage specification by 200 V. This higher voltage rating accommodates applications requiring additional voltage margin or where circuit design incorporates higher transient voltages. The forward voltage drop is lower (1.1 V at 5 A), and the package remains compatible (DO-214AB, SMC). All compliance certifications align with the S5KL-TP. This part is suitable for substitution in applications where the higher voltage rating does not create design constraints.

STTH310S (STMicroelectronics)

The STTH310S is rated for 1000 V DC reverse voltage but with a reduced current rating of 3 A, which is below the S5KL-TP specification of 5 A. This part exhibits fast recovery characteristics (≤500 ns) compared to the standard recovery speed of the S5KL-TP (>500 ns). The forward voltage drop is significantly higher (1.7 V at 3 A). The STTH310S is not suitable for direct substitution in applications requiring 5 A continuous current. This part is applicable only in circuits where the maximum current requirement does not exceed 3 A and where fast recovery characteristics provide circuit performance benefits.

Frequently Asked Questions (FAQ)

Q: Can the S5KC-13-F replace the S5KL-TP in all applications?

A: Yes. The S5KC-13-F meets or exceeds all critical electrical parameters of the S5KL-TP: 800 V reverse voltage rating, 5 A current rating, identical package (DO-214AB, SMC), and equivalent compliance certifications. The lower forward voltage drop (1.15 V versus 1.2 V) and extended low-temperature operating range (-65°C versus -55°C) represent performance improvements.

Q: Is the S5M_R1_00001 suitable for the S5KL-TP application?

A: The S5M_R1_00001 is suitable for substitution provided the circuit design accommodates the higher 1000 V voltage rating. The part meets the 5 A current requirement and maintains package compatibility. The lower forward voltage drop (1.1 V) may improve efficiency. Verify that the higher voltage rating does not create design conflicts or introduce unintended circuit behavior.

Q: Why is the STTH310S listed as a substitute if it has lower current rating?

A: The STTH310S is listed as a substitute part but is not recommended for direct replacement in applications requiring 5 A continuous current. This part is applicable only in circuits where maximum current does not exceed 3 A. The fast recovery characteristic (≤500 ns) may provide benefits in specific switching applications where recovery speed is critical.

Q: Are all substitute parts available in the same packaging format?

A: Yes. All substitute parts are supplied in DO-214AB, SMC package format with Surface Mount mounting type. All parts are available in Tape & Reel (TR) or Cut Tape (CT) packaging options suitable for automated assembly processes.

Q: What compliance certifications apply to all parts in this comparison?

A: All parts listed (S5KL-TP, S5KC-13-F, S5M_R1_00001, and STTH310S) are ROHS3 compliant, REACH unaffected, and classified as Moisture Sensitivity Level 1 (Unlimited). All parts are classified as Active product status.

Q: How do forward voltage drops affect circuit performance?

A: Forward voltage drop (Vf) directly impacts power dissipation and efficiency in rectifier circuits. The S5KL-TP specifies 1.2 V at 5 A, while the S5KC-13-F and S5M_R1_00001 specify lower values (1.15 V and 1.1 V respectively). Lower forward voltage reduces heat generation and improves overall power conversion efficiency. The STTH310S specifies 1.7 V at 3 A, which is higher and results in greater power dissipation.

Q: What is the significance of recovery speed classification?

A: Recovery speed indicates the time required for the diode to transition from forward conduction to reverse blocking state. Standard recovery (>500 ns) is suitable for general-purpose rectification and power supply applications. Fast recovery (≤500 ns) is beneficial in high-frequency switching circuits where reduced recovery time minimizes switching losses and improves efficiency. The S5KL-TP, S5KC-13-F, and S5M_R1_00001 are standard recovery devices, while the STTH310S is fast recovery.
